What is sales tax in Labette?

Sales tax in Labette is a consumption tax imposed on the sale of goods and services. It is collected by retailers at the point of sale and then remitted to the government. This tax is a significant source of revenue for the state and local governments, helping fund public services and infrastructure.

Sales taxable and exempt items in Labette

In Labette, certain items are subject to sales tax, while others are exempt. Understanding these distinctions is essential for both businesses and consumers:

  • Taxable Items: Clothing, electronics, and household goods are generally subject to Labette sales tax.
  • Exempt Items: Groceries, prescription medications, and certain agricultural supplies are typically exempt from sales tax in Labette.

How sales tax is calculated in Labette

Sales tax in Labette is calculated based on the total sale price of taxable goods and services. The Labette sales tax rate is applied to this amount, and the resulting figure is the tax owed. Businesses can use a Labette sales tax calculator to ensure accurate calculations.

Differences between sales tax and use tax in Labette

While sales tax is collected at the point of sale, use tax is imposed on goods purchased out of state but used in Labette. This ensures that local businesses are not at a disadvantage compared to out-of-state sellers.

Physical presence and sales tax nexus in Labette

A business must have a physical presence or nexus in Labette to be required to collect sales tax. This can include having a storefront, warehouse, or even employees in the county.

Eligibility for a sales tax permit in Labette

Businesses that sell taxable goods or services in Labette must obtain a sales tax permit. This process involves registering with the Kansas Department of Revenue and fulfilling specific requirements.

What to do if you miss a filing deadline in Labette

If a business misses a sales tax filing deadline in Labette, it should immediately contact the Kansas Department of Revenue. Penalties and interest may apply, but prompt communication can help mitigate these consequences.

Kansas State Income Tax Rates & Brackets for 2023

The following tables represents Kansas's income tax rates and tax brackets:

SINGLE FILER

Brackets

Rates

$0 - $15,000

3.10%

$15,000 - $30,000

5.25%

$30,000+

5.70%

MARRIED FILING JOINTLY

Brackets

Rates

$0 - $30,000

3.10%

$30,000 - $60,000

5.25%

$60,000+

5.70%

Filing Status

Standard Deduction Amt.

Single

$3,500

Couple

$5,750
